PROVINCIAL CHAMPIONSHIPS

The five polo Provinces (Natal, Cape, Free State, Highveld & East Griqualand) host their own Provincial Championships. These are usually three-day tournaments that are held in the earlier part of the winter season after which the Provincial teams that compete in the Inter-Provincial Tournament are announced. Senior players and promising youngsters vie with each other in these important Championships as they are the first rung on the ladder towards selection for Provincial and then National teams.

CAPE CHAMPS 2011 RESULTS
This had to be cancelled due to the Cape Town players not being able to bring their horses up to Plett due to an AHS outbreak.
